Another day, another festival. Last week it was Coachella, yesterday it was Firefly, and today it’s the long-awaited announcement of the 2014 Governors Ball festival in NYC. It takes place from June 6 – 8 at Randall’s Island Park in NYC, and tickets go on sale at 3pm, so clear your schedule so you can make sure you get them! They’ve got a stacked lineup this year including a recently reunited Outkast, Jack White, and Vampire Weekend at the top of the bill. Foster the People have announced their highly anticipated sophomore record Supermodel, which is due out on March 18th. They’ve premiered a brand new music video for the first single “Coming of Age” in tandem, which you can watch below. Pre-order Supermodel here on January 14th. So far the only tour dates they have are a stint at the now-sold-out Coachella festival, but considering the relentless touring they did for their debut, we’ll be seeing a lot of them in 2014. httpvh://www.youtube.com/watch?v=XMQb_FcydxM&feature=youtu.be
The Gunz Show had an in depth interview with Skate and Surf creator John D’Esposito in which John explained a lot of the behind-the-scenes happenings with the Bamboozle festival, including exactly what went wrong with and who was to blame for his departure. He also discusses the reformation of the Skate and Surf Festival and the start of GameChanger World.

As Record Store Day approaches on April 16, the fourth annual event continues to be an increasingly valued channel through which to sell music.
The number of stores expected to participate will be about the same as last year: about 1,400 around the world.
